Activer ou désactiver le complément

Anonim

Comment activer ou désactiver un complément à l'aide d'une macro

Pour certaines macros, il est important que certains compléments soient installés. Par exemple, pensez à des solutions qui utilisent des fonctions de table du complément Analysis Functions. Cela inclut des fonctionnalités telles que FIN DE MOIS.

Si vous passez un tableau dans lequel une telle fonction est utilisée, mais que le complément n'est pas activé sur le PC concerné, Excel affiche un message d'erreur et le calcul complet ne peut pas être effectué.

Avec la commande "Extras - Add-Ins" ou "Extras - Add-Ins-Manager" dans les anciennes versions d'Excel, vous pouvez ouvrir la boîte de dialogue avec laquelle vous pouvez activer ou désactiver les compléments. L'illustration suivante montre à quoi cela peut ressembler :

Un complément qui est toujours inclus dans la liste est le complément "Fonctions d'analyse". Si vous souhaitez activer ce complément automatiquement via une macro, utilisez le code de programme suivant :

Sous AddInActiver ()
AddIns ("Fonctions d'analyse"). Installé = True
Fin du sous-marin

Vous pouvez également activer n'importe quel autre complément avec cette commande, à condition qu'il soit déjà dans la liste des compléments.

Pour désactiver un complément, remplacez l'affectation de valeur Vrai par l'expression Faux.

Au fait : dans Excel 2007, toutes les fonctions qui étaient incluses dans le complément "Fonctions d'analyse" dans les versions antérieures sont disponibles immédiatement et sans avoir besoin d'un complément.